Choosing the right location for your trip is a huge contributing factor, as mistakenly opting for the wrong place could mean that your staycation is not a positive experience. Think about what you would like to get from your trip – do you want to relax in rural tranquil settings? Or are you searching for a city break rich in culture, restaurants and nightlife? This should help you to determine which location works for you, as there’s no doubt about the fact that your home country can accommodate both high and low energy trips.
The accommodation that you opt for when booking your staycation can either make or break your holiday, as a week in a one star B&B is enough to cause even the most optimistic of individuals to crack. There are so many unique and traditional options to explore, from self catering cottage holidays to modern high tech hotels. Even a stay at a luxurious spa retreat might be available! There’s really no point in holding back when choosing your accommodation, as the money you save on flights can be redistributed to make sure you have the best time possible!
Discovering which activities are on offer in the location that you choose can help you to plan out your trip properly, as it’s more than likely that you are able to pre book your tickets online to avoid queuing and further hassle upon arrival. Nature focused staycations might benefit from a guided ramble or even white water rafting, whilst a city trip is better suited to museum and art gallery tours.
